To keep getting your Canada child benefit (CCB) and related provincial and territorial payments, you must file your tax return on time every year. If you have a spouse or common-law partner, they also have to file their tax return on time every year. You must file your tax return even if your ...

WebWho can get the Canada child benefit. You must meet all of the following conditions: You live with a child who is under 18 years of age. You are primarily responsible for the care and upbringing of the child. See who is primarily responsible. You are a resident of Canada for tax purposes. WebChild benefit is a monthly payment for anyone with parental responsibilities for children under the age of 16 (or up to 20 for children in full-time education).
